What's a Bachelor of Laws?

A Bachelor of Laws, or LLB for short, is like a special school degree for people who want to be lawyers. It's the first big step in learning all about laws and how they help keep our communities safe and fair. Think of it as learning the rulebook for grown-ups!

This degree teaches you important things like how to understand tricky rules and how to help people when they have problems that laws can fix. It's a super important start for anyone dreaming of wearing a judge's robe or helping people in court!

How Do You Get This Cool Degree?

To get a Bachelor of Laws degree, you usually go to university for a few years. You'll spend your time learning about all sorts of laws, like the ones about crimes, or buying and selling things, or even family rules. You'll also practice reading and writing about laws, and learn how to argue your case.

It's like going to a special school to become a law expert! After you finish, you can then take more tests to become a real practicing lawyer, ready to help people with their legal needs.
